Informations sur le produit

Hygromycin B from Streptomyces hygroscopicus is a potent antibiotic known for its effectiveness against a broad spectrum of Gram-negative bacteria and certain Gram-positive strains. This compound is particularly valued in microbiological research and biotechnology for its ability to selectively inhibit protein synthesis, making it an essential tool in the study of gene expression and function. Hygromycin B is widely used in molecular biology laboratories for the selection of genetically modified organisms, especially in plant and mammalian cell systems, where it serves as a reliable marker for successful transformation.

In addition to its applications in research, Hygromycin B has potential therapeutic implications, particularly in the development of new antibiotics and treatments for bacterial infections. Its unique mechanism of action, which disrupts ribosomal function, sets it apart from other antibiotics, offering a promising avenue for combating antibiotic resistance. Applications

Hygromycin B from Streptomyces hygroscopicus is widely utilized in research focused on:

  • Antibiotic Research: It serves as a potent antibiotic, particularly in studies investigating bacterial resistance mechanisms and the development of new antimicrobial agents.
  • Gene Selection: Commonly used in molecular biology, it acts as a selective agent for transgenic cells, helping researchers identify successfully modified organisms in plant and animal studies.
  • Cell Culture Applications: In cell culture, it is employed to maintain the integrity of genetically modified cell lines, ensuring that only those expressing the desired traits survive.
  • Veterinary Medicine: Hygromycin B is utilized in veterinary applications to treat infections in livestock, providing a reliable option for managing bacterial diseases.
  • Biotechnology: It plays a crucial role in the production of recombinant proteins, aiding in the selection of high-yielding cell lines for biopharmaceutical manufacturing.
